Transaction 158232121f267b694fa0d96f9ed49431d43595cfdc65f30be76c9205c4607aa6
1 Input
1 Output
-
158232121f267b694fa0d96f9ed49431d43595cfdc65f30be76c9205c4607aa6:0
- value
- 676281
- script pubkey
- OP_0 OP_PUSHBYTES_20 d690d5977292d402a7e9e222fc81802f9c8269b2
- address
- bc1q66gdt9mjjt2q9flfug30eqvq97wgy6djwjv7s3